If you really desperately need "something more powerful" I suppose the 
only way is to introduce a second GUI Window. This will might if you are 
using a multi-Core System.

Obviously it is possible to create a second GUI Windows by starting a 
second executable (and have same communicate with the main executable by 
means such as Windows Messages, Pipes and/or shared RAM.

It might (or might not) be possible to create a second GUI Windows by 
using the second copy of the LCL that is created by a DLL / *.so and 
create a second application with same in a thread. Bus as nobody did 
decently try this yet, you are on your own evaluating this. (See the 
recent  thread on DLL in this forum) Let us know where you get.
